I know that you have to make advanced reservations for the character breakfasts and for some restaurants if you want priorit seating. I know that it is 120 days out. My question, is it 120 days out from when you get there or from the exact day of the meal? Also, I want to send the kids on the pirate crusie but am not sure when it is scheduled to run. Where is that info? Thanks. We are going Oct. 27 through Nov. 3 so our 120 days out is coming up quick!

We travel during the busy summer months so we figure PSs are vital. The PS is from the actual date of the meal, some being 120 days before, many of the popular ones are 60 days before.

I'm going to try to do a hyperlink, but I'm not sure if it will work.

This is a general information page that tells what a PS is and which meals are 120 and which are 60. http://www.wdwinfo.com/wdwinfo/priorityseating.htm

This is a calculator. You put in your dates and the meal and it will figure what day to call. http://www.wdwinfo.com/wdwinfo/dining/pscalc/dispscalc.html

For the really popular ones, (ie, breakfast with the princesses called Cinderella's Royal Table ) you need to call first thing in the morning. What most of us who are successful do is start calling about 10 minutes before 7 a.m. EST and keep pushing redial until a live person answers. Then you need to tell them quickly the Cinderella's, date, number in party. The first available comes up in the system, I believe. Take that, because usually if they put another time in the system, all PSs can be gone.
